Known as “Mandatory Event Data Recorders,” the devices would be capable of monitoring your speed, driving habits, location, and distance traveled.  Removal of the device would be a civil offense. – American Thinker

 

 

By Brian Sussman at American Thinker


EXCERPTS:

It’s all because of a vague provision slipped into bill, which has already passed the U.S. Senate and is likely to be rubber-stamped by the House.

 

Known as the “Moving Ahead for Progress in the 21st Century Act,” SB 1813 ….

 

The legislation would declare it mandatory for all new cars in the U.S. to be fitted with black box-like data recorders beginning in 2015.

 

The text of  never specifically states why such information needs to be collected by the government, …. the government would have the authority to retrieve the data in a number of circumstances, including by court order, and pursuant to an investigation or inspection conducted by the secretary of transportation.
